Dave Harte has found a picture of how the Bull Ring Boat will look this summer:
Firefox

He’s also found details of a ‘Mr Sexy Legs’ competition and the usual music supplied by Galaxy.

The boat also has a logo:
Google%20Mail%20-%20Bullring%20Britannia%20VIP%20PREVIEW%20-%20jonbounds@gmail.com

It’ll be open from noon on the 4th of June.

Fans of sand will be glad to know that the Rainbow pub in Digbeth with be having a traditional brummie beach this summer. (Thanks to Tom Scotney for the tip).
